Key Responsibilities

  • •Receive, inspect, and organize new shipments; ensure items are properly labeled, tagged, and stocked.
  • •Maintain operational standards through coaching, training, and accountability on the sales floor and in the backroom.
  • •Keep the stockroom organized and tidy, arranging footwear by size, style, and type for efficient restocking.
  • •Assist with inventory counts and stock audits to maintain accurate records and reduce discrepancies.
  • •Support daily retail operations including POS system management, stock replenishment, pricing/markdown processes, loyalty program promotion, and cleanliness/recovery standards.

Key Requirements

  • •2–3 years of total retail and stockroom experience (store leadership experience preferred).
  • •Flexibility to work nights, weekends, holidays, and extended hours with regular attendance.
  • •Strong communication and interpersonal skills to build rapport with consumers and teammates.
  • •Proactive, detail-oriented approach to completing tasks efficiently.
  • •Commitment to representing the Crocs brand and its values as a brand ambassador.

Company Brief

Crocs Inc.
Designs, manufactures, and sells casual footwear and accessories known for its proprietary Croslite™ material. Crocs offers a range of comfortable, lightweight shoes and related products globally through wholesale, retail, and e-commerce channels.
